Understanding Recycled HDPE


Recycled HDPE sheets are made from post-consumer waste, primarily consisting of used plastic bottles, containers, and other HDPE products. The recycling process involves cleaning, shredding, and reprocessing the plastic into sheets that can be used for various applications. By using rHDPE, we can significantly reduce the environmental impact of plastic waste, conserve natural resources, and promote a circular economy.


Environmental Benefits


One of the most significant advantages of using recycled HDPE sheets is their positive impact on the environment. The production of virgin HDPE not only requires extensive fossil fuel consumption but also releases a considerable amount of greenhouse gases. In contrast, recycling HDPE requires significantly less energy and resources. For instance, recycling one ton of HDPE can save up to 3.5 tons of carbon dioxide emissions. By opting for rHDPE sheets, companies can reduce their carbon footprint and contribute to a more sustainable future.


Moreover, the use of recycled materials helps to mitigate plastic pollution in landfills and oceans. As the world grapples with the ever-growing issue of plastic waste, rHDPE sheets provide an effective solution by repurposing existing materials rather than producing new ones. This reduces the overall demand for single-use plastics and supports efforts to minimize environmental contamination.


Versatile Applications

Recycled HDPE sheets are incredibly versatile and can be used in a multitude of applications. In the construction industry, for instance, rHDPE sheets are often used for exterior cladding, roofing systems, and even as structural components due to their strength and resistance to weathering. Their lightweight nature and resistance to impact make them an ideal choice for various building projects.


In addition to construction, rHDPE sheets are commonly utilized in manufacturing durable, weather-resistant products such as outdoor furniture, storage containers, and playground equipment. These applications not only showcase the material's longevity but also highlight its potential to withstand harsh environmental conditions, making it a preferred choice for outdoor use.


Furthermore, rHDPE sheets are also found in the automotive and packaging industries. Their ability to be molded and shaped into specific designs makes them ideal for producing lightweight automotive parts and various packaging solutions. As companies increasingly strive to meet sustainability goals, the demand for recycled materials in these sectors is expected to grow.
